In our area, many of the homes were built with crawl spaces instead of basements. For a long time, they were constructed with open vents which was intended to increase fresh air flow into the area and keep it dry. Unfortunately, this is rarely what happens. Having open vents allows water to enter the space during rain and snow storms and then it never leaves which results in the humidity level staying too high which will eventually harbor the growth of mildew. We have found that up to ½ of the air in your home can come up through the crawl space so ensuring the crawl space is closed off from the outside and controlling excess humidity can increase the overall air quality in your home.

Our team has been working with crawl spaces since 1995 and we know the best way to seal them off and control the humidity. We do this using a method known as encapsulation which is the installation of a heavy duty liner, sometimes accompanied by insulation products, which are heavy duty plastic and vinyl sheets as well as vent covers and a sturdy door that can seal the area completely and stop any unwanted moisture from entering. Encapsulation will also stop pests and animals from getting in the crawl space which will keep any equipment there safe and allow you to use it for storage. Foundation Cracks in Birdsnest

The homes foundation is quite possibly one of, if not the, most important parts. It not only supports the structure itself but it also forms the basement walls. If there are foundation problems, normally they will manifest themselves as diagonal cracks in your brickwork, long cracks that run the length of the foundation or along basement walls. You may also notice that your doors or windows will stick when you open or close them or even cracks at the corners of them. While these issues may not seem serious when you notice them, they are all indicative of a sinking or settling foundation and they should be evaluated by an expert for particular problems to determine if a repair needs to be installed.

Thankfully, the most common foundation problems stem from similar issues and our team is very good at tracking down these problems. We can offer a repair solution that is for your particular issue to permanently repair and stabilize the foundation. If the problem is a sloping foundation, we can implement a series of foundation piers to level the foundation. We will install either push piers or helical piers, depending on where and how bad the sinking is. Both types of piers are very strong and are able to stabilize your foundation.
